Do I need to go to court for this matter?
Most Probate matters in Greensborough, VIC are resolved through the application process without requiring a court appearance. However, in rare situations such as when beneficiaries contest the will, questions arise about the estate's validity, or disagreements emerge over asset distribution, court or tribunal involvement may become necessary to resolve these disputes. A lawyer can advise whether court involvement is required and which court or tribunal applies to your situation.

How much do Probate lawyers cost in Greensborough, VIC?
Probate lawyers in Greensborough, VIC generally charge between $300 and $600 per hour, with rates varying based on the lawyer's experience, location and firm size. The total cost of your matter depends on how much time is required to complete the probate process. Straightforward probate applications with minimal complications typically require fewer hours and fall at the lower end of the cost spectrum. Matters involving estate disputes, contested wills, or beneficiary disagreements demand significantly more preparation, research, and potentially court appearances, resulting in higher total costs. Complex probate matters requiring extensive asset valuations or involving family provision claims often require the most time and expertise. Actual fees vary depending on the lawyer and the circumstances of the matter.

What are the most common Probate matters in Greensborough, VIC?
In Greensborough, VIC, probate lawyers frequently handle applications for grants of probate when someone dies with a valid will, letters of administration for estates without wills, contested estate matters where beneficiaries dispute distributions, family provision claims challenging will provisions, and estate administration guidance including asset distribution and debt settlement. Many practitioners also assist with will validation issues when the document's authenticity or validity comes into question.
What documents do I need for a Probate lawyer in Greensborough, VIC?
When meeting with a probate lawyer in Greensborough, VIC, it can help to have the deceased's will (if available), death certificate, and identification for yourself as the potential executor. You may be asked to provide details about the estate's assets, including property deeds, bank statements, superannuation details, and investment records. If available, insurance policies, outstanding debts documentation, and beneficiary contact information can be useful for your consultation. Only a lawyer can confirm what documents are required for your situation. Some Australia Post offices offer services like certified copies, photo ID, or printing.
